Essentials Quote by Jeffrey Pfeffer
“With respect to trust, people tell me that it is essential for organizational functioning. Maybe, but most surveys of trust find that trust in leaders is low and nonetheless, organizations role along quite nicely.”
About This Quote
Source Book: “Power: Why Some People Have It and Others Don't” by Jeffrey Pfeffer, 2010
Trust is touted as essential, yet low trust does not stop organizations from functioning.
In simple terms: Organizations can work despite low trust.
Build systems that function with or without trust.
